USE OF D (drive) IN AUTOMATICS CARS:

In automatic cars, D stands for (Drive), D is the top gear setting on an automatic transmission. Almost in all vehicles, D is overdrive and the purpose of D is to save fuel.

USE OF R (reverse) IN AUTOMATIC CARS:

In automatic cars, R stands for (reverse) or it’s the gear selected to drive the vehicle backwards. In these cars when we shift the gear lever from P to R then the automatic transmission’s reverse gear is engaged and spins the drive shaft backwards and allows the drive wheels to spin in reverse or backward.

USE OF N (neutral) IN AUTOMATIC CARS:

In automatic cars, N stands for (neutral) basically N is an indicator in automatics cars that tells you that tour automatic transmission is in NEUTRAL or in free-spinning mode.

USE OF P (parking) IN AUTOMATIC CARS:

In automatic cars, P stands for (parking), so; when the gear shifter is in P (park) the transmission gears are locked which restricts the wheels to spin forward or backwards many of the peoples use the park settings as a brake.

Steps to start automatic cars are given below:

Following are the steps to be taken before you start an automatic car:

  1. At first insert key into the ignition
  2. Now twist the ignition key to start the car
  3. Put the gearstick in “P” or “N” position
  4. Then shift into gear
  5. Look into your mirrors to avoid any objects, or cars and peoples to drive safely
